Meet a member: St. Alexius Foundation

St. Alexius Foundation

St. Alexius Foundation's mission is to advocate and advance the healing presence of CHI St. Alexius Health for the benefit of the patients, families, associates and communities they serve.

St. Alexius Foundation was established in 1988 as the philanthropic arm of CHI St. Alexius Health. The purpose of St. Alexius Foundation is to receive, recognize and manage donations of cash and other assets which support the programs, services and technologies at CHI St. Alexius Health.

CHI St. Alexius Health was established in 1885 by a group of Benedictine Sisters who recognized a need for healthcare in this region. It is a nonprofit, community-owned hospital. In 2012, St. Alexius' community benefit was $31,156,399, which helped to provide access to healthcare for all, fund the unpaid costs of the uninsured or underinsured, and support education and prevention programs in our community.
